Final Results Released in 48th District Election

Share
From Times Staff Reports

SANTA ANA

Republican state Sen. John Campbell of Irvine emerged with 45.5% of the vote in last week’s special election to succeed Rep. Christopher Cox (R-Newport Beach) in the 48th Congressional District, according to final results posted Monday.

Campbell, who received 41,420 votes, will join the top vote-getters from four other parties in a Dec. 6 showdown. The five finalists will include American Independent Party candidate Jim Gilchrist, who came in third behind former Assemblywoman Marilyn C. Brewer.

Among voters casting ballots on election day, however, Gilchrist got the second-most votes behind Campbell. He ended up with 13,423, nearly 15%. Brewer got 17%, with 15,595 votes.
